Bawdsey lies on the estuary of the River Deben, where walkers and weekend sailors sit outside the pubs gazing across to the pine forests and heathland of the Bawdsey Peninsula. Nearby, Bawdsey Manor was where radar was developed and there are lots of historical sites to visit around the area. There is also a sandy beach for children, and sailing at Bawdsey Quay only two miles away. From here you can take the foot ferry to Felixstowe Ferry just across the river.

Standing just a few metres from the coastal cliff south of Aldeburgh and Orford, Rose Cottage is in an ideal location for touring the Heritage Coast.  Woodbridge, Sutton Hoo, RSPB Minsmere, are all within an easy drive.  Beautifully refurbished to provide a comfortable, spacious, and delightful base, this property has a large fenced garden overlooking the sea as well as its own paddock.  There are lovely walks in the surrounding countryside and good pubs and restaurants within a couple of miles at Woodbridge and Orford. Bawdsey (one mile) has tennis courts and a children's play area. Beach is ten minutes walk. Bawdsey Quay with sandy beach, water sports and sailing school is two miles. Shop: 2 miles Pub: 2 miles
